Can we go back to Joan Vassos winning the Courageous Women Award in New York City?
Yeah, let's talk about that.
Joan's late husband, passed away from pancreatic cancer.
and she has been a big advocate since having her platform.
She was recently in New York City to promote her participation in the pan-can purple stridewalk.
And while she was there, they awarded her the 26 Courageous Woman Award, which was really awesome.
She took a picture, posted on Instagram of her in Times Square, reflecting on the moment.
She said, one honor to be a recipient of the living abundantly with Sarah V.
Courageous Woman Award.
And she just said that she's really appreciated for them recognizing her work
and allowing her to have a space to share her story.
